Crazed fans stop basketball game

Mar 07, 2007
By TBT Staff

VILNIUS - An SEB Basketball League game between Zalgiris Kaunas and Lietuvos Rytas Vilnius on March 3 was stopped in its last minutes by officials when out-of-control fans made conditions too dangerous for the play to continue. Television viewers watched as wild fans chanted and threw beer cans at players in the Kaunas Sports Hall, stopping the game with just under two minutes left on the clock.
